**I've studied the graphs in some considerable detail over the years and
have noted that CO2 rise sometimes precedes temperature rise and sometimes
it lags. This fits in well with current theory on how temperature changes
have occured in the past. Not all have been caused by CO2 rise. The most
important factor to note, however, is that CO2 levels and temperature levels
track each other very closely. When one goes up, the other does too.


You can't have it both ways. Either warming causes a CO2 increase, or
CO2 causes a warming increase. Since they track each other, it's
presumed that there's a cause and effect mechanism in operation. If
your claim of mutual causality were true, where an increase in either
factor causes an increase in the other, then that's positive feedback.
Temperature and CO2 would simply increase without any limit, causing
the planet to look like Venus. We've survived 5 temperature cycles in
the last 500,000 years which demonstrates that it's NOT postive
feedback.

http://rps3.com/Files/AGW/VOSTOKICECoreObservations_Stewart2009.pdf
Assuming the five temperature maximums are related to the 1st
Order 100,000 year Milankovitch cycles, CO2 had little effect
is maintaining the high temperatures. As seen in Cycle 4,
even though CO2 levels were at maximum 299 ppmv CO2,
temperature did not continue to increase, but actually made
a abrupt reversal. Therefore it appears that the mechanical
temperature rise & fall associated with 1st order Milankovitch
cycles appear to overwhelm any warming effect associated with
CO2, for CO2 levels below 299 ppmv;
